Excerpt from The Lay of Dolon: The Tenth Book of Homer's ILI AN author has been known to palh'ate his boldness in making a book by saying he has written it to supply a want. The same plea is ventured on behalf of the present work. It may, at first sight, seem difficult to make good such a justification for a contribution to the Homeric Question. The literature of that problem is already of a fullness to defy the bibliographer. And it grows incessantly. Those who try to keep abreast of it in its many branches long for a pause which does not come. There was a brief but welcome lull some years ago. Controversy almost ceased for a time, while disputants fell back and sought to reckon up gain and loss. But the Lachmann drum was beaten afresh; and the Cretan discoveries, the novelties of the Saga-searchers, the restless strivings of the Culturists, the speculations of Professor Murray and the arguments of Mr. Andrew Lang, have all helped to stimulate discussion. 73x06 8' Miss Stawell has dealt a heavy blow where it was least expected. The contest is active once more. In Homeric phrase they battle on relent lessly. An enumeration of only the treatises and essays which have appeared during the four years that the present book has occupied, would require a bulky Appendix.
